I am an Assistant Professor of English and First-Year Composition Coordinator at CUNY Medgar Evers College, where I teach rhetoric, writing, and literature courses. I also teach a course entitled "The Italian Experience In The United States" at CUNY York College.

 

My research focuses on the intersections of translingual rhetorics, critical digital literacy, and Italian Studies.

 

I am the recipient of a 2023-2024 CUNY Andrew W. Mellon Foundation Black, Race, and Ethnic Studies Initiative Grant. 

 

Some of my service work includes being a CUNY Writing Discipline Council Representative and a MEC Computers and Technology Committee delegate for the English Department. These are roles that continuously fuel my commitment to diversity and inclusion.
